Atomiswave : Naomi
#255467 - 05/24/11 10:09 PM
|
|
|
Can anyone here tell me the differences between these two systems ? Why they have different source driver in MAME ? From what I see and read about it(mainly my experience is from DEMUL) they look completely the same, except the logo on starting screen.

Naomi (by Sega) was first and used a GD-ROM or roms. Atomiswave was designed based on Naomi (by Sammy) which used interchangeable carts (rom only). I'm sure there are other minor differences as well, but they are different systems made by different companies, even if they are mostly alike.

Naomi has substantially more memory (including VRAM) than the stock Dreamcast. Atomiswave has exactly the same specs as the home Dreamcast and was intended as a low-end low-cost solution.
